This past week at Brickworld Indy I noticed that all of my tan 16X32 baseplates
were a different shade of tan than all of my 32X32 tan baseplates.
 
Part No: 3857  Name: Baseplate 16 x 32
* 
3857 Baseplate 16 x 32
Parts: Baseplate
My tan 32X32 BPs appear to be the same color as any tan brick or other regular
part in tan. However, all of my 16X32 BPs are slightly darker and more yellow.
The difference was, of course, most noticeable when I had the BPs right next
to each other on my display.

The tan 16X32 BP has been in 16 sets over the years, 14 of which were from 1996
to 2002. I have bought all of my tan 16X32 BPs from various sources, and they
are all the same not-quite-LEGO-tan color. There were a couple of Spongebob
sets in 2006 and 2008 that had a tan 16X32 BP. I imagine that none of my BPs
are new enough to be from those most recent sets.

I was wondering, does anyone out there have any tan 16X32 BPs that you know are
from the Spongebob sets, and can verify if they match the shade of other tan
LEGO parts?

I don't think that this exists yet, though I could be wrong. I searched the
Help section and couldn't find anything about it.

I think it would be useful to have a password-guarded option to let certain
people pay a seller by a method that is not available to other buyers.


My store has PayPal, Cashier's Check and Money Orders as payment methods. Just
today I had a person, who I've been friends with for years in my own LUG, order
from me. Typically when he orders from my Bricklink store, I bring the parts
to our next LUG meeting, and he pays me in cash. My store doesn't accept cash
as a payment type (which is pretty typical here). My friend has to click one
of the 3 payment types to let the order go through, despite the fact that he
knows he won't be paying by that method.

Now you may be thinking, "Why don't you just add 'Cash' as a payment type in
your store? Only the people who are going to see you in person to pick up their
order would click that payment method." Yeah...that should be how it
would work. I have a feeling that if I add "Cash" to my payment methods, someone
would inadvertently click that payment type, when that's not really what they're
going to use.

If this suggestion is implemented, I could add Cash and Check as payment options
to my store, and give out the password only to members of my LUG. I would set
the other 3 payment types to be the default set of payment options in my store
and not require a password. Then there should be no mixups when people who I
will never see in person or newbies select how they want to pay.
